Limitations of the contour detection method

The example shown in the previous subsection looks very good in terms of object detection. We did not have to do any training and, with a little adjustment of a few parameters, we were able to detect the oranges and apples correctly. However, we will add the following variations and see if our detector is still able to detect the objects correctly:

  • We will add objects other than apples and oranges.
  • We will add another object with a similar shape to apples and oranges.
  • We will change the light intensity and reflection.

If we execute the same code from the previous subsection, it will detect every object as if it is an apple. This is because the width and height parameters selected were too broad ...
